12-Minute Garlic Steak Bites (Air Fryer or Skillet!)

Course: Main Course
Cuisine: American
Prep Time: 5 minutes
Cook Time: 7 minutes
Total Time: 12 minutes
Servings: 5 servings
Calories: 183kcal
Author: Lauren
These easy Seared Garlic Steak Bites (Air Fryer or Skillet!) are out-of-this world flavorful and juicy and ready in just 12 minutes! Perfect to throw in tacos, bowls, salads, wraps or simply enjoy with your favorite sides. Seriously the easiest way to cook steak!
Print Recipe

Ingredients

  • 16 oz. sirloin steak
  • 1/2 Tbsp olive oil
  • 2 tsp brown sugar
  • 1 tsp garlic powder
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1/2 tsp black pepper
  • 1/2 tsp chili powder
  • 1/4 tsp dried parsley
  • Fresh parsley optional, for garnishing

Instructions

  • Cut steak into bite-sized pieces.
  • In a small bowl, toss steak with olive oil and seasonings until evenly coated and set aside.
  • Bring a skillet to medium heat and spray with nonstick cooking spray (or oil if preferred). When warm, add steak. Cook for 7-8 minutes for well done steak, stirring a couple of times through. Or, cook until your desired internal color/temperature.
